MOVIE REVIEW: Wonderstruck

Haynes’ Wonderstruck still evokes true and impassioned power.  The film strides within a sensitive middle ground of approachable and praiseworthy quaintness in addressing difficult youthful challenges and emotions.  The effect is a grown-up experience audiences can, and should, appreciate compared to the mindless popcorn fluff and weightless distractions studio shovel into the PG marketplace.  If a new definition could be created for the term “wonderstruck,” it would read “rapt attention.”
